Responsibilities
  • Prepare patients for surgical procedures, monitor vital signs, administer medications, and provide post-operative care in the Day Surgery department.
  • Collaborate closely with surgeons, anesthetists, and other healthcare professionals to ensure seamless patient experiences.
  • Engage with diverse cases in a fast-paced environment to apply and expand clinical skills.
  • Participate in ongoing training and team meetings to stay abreast of best practices and innovations in patient care.
  • Maintain flexible scheduling typical of PRN roles, adapting to fluctuating demands of the surgical unit.
Are you the Registered Nurse (RN) Day Surgery we re looking for?
  • Strong foundation in clinical nursing skills, particularly pre-operative and post-operative care.
  • Excellent communication abilities for interacting with diverse patient populations and multidisciplinary teams.
  •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to stay calm under pressure.
  • Empathy and a customer-centric approach to enhance patient comfort and trust.
  • Attention to detail and adherence to safety protocols.
  • Adaptability to varying patient needs and schedules in a fast-paced surgical environment.
